An “enormous” Canada goose busted through an English woman’s front door, sending her into panic when she initially mistook the bewildered bird for a would-be thief. Lynne Sewell and a friend were watching TV Wednesday night when a thunderous bang startled her — and she soon discovered the fowl intruder wedged in the glass of the door to her Leicestershire home, the BBC reported.
“My friend went out first because I was scared — and he shouted ‘there’s a bird with its head through the glass,’” Sewell said. “I was scared by the loud bang to start with, and it was enormous. I thought it was probably someone trying to kick the door or something.”
The stunned friends called police and animal rescue, but with no one available that late, they made sure to keep the goose comfortable with a blanket and food until morning, hoping it would survive the night. The Leicestershire Wildlife Hospital in Kibworth Harcourt arrived the next morning to scoop up the feathered visitor, which only suffered a few cuts and is expected to return to the wild, the BBC reported.
Rescuer Amy Blower believes the fatigued bird may have tired itself out in flight and misjudged its landing. “It’s very usual to be in the middle of a housing estate and flying that late at night,” Blower said. The goose will be released back into the wild after being treated with pain medication and antibiotics.
Sewell has since boarded up her front door and arranged for it to be repaired, but is relieved the befuddled bird will make a full recovery.
